蚂蚁金服开源SQLFlow:让技术人员调用AI像SQL一样简单

新知榜官方账号

2023-09-18 19:04:18

在QCon全球软件开发大会(北京站)2019上,蚂蚁金服副CTO胡喜正式宣布开源机器学习工具SQLFlow。SQLFlow的目标是将SQL引擎和AI引擎连接起来,让用户仅需几行SQL代码就能描述整个应用或者产品背后的数据流和AI构造。SQLFlow能够抽象出端到端从数据到模型的研发过程,配合底层的引擎及自动优化,具备基础SQL知识的技术人员即可完成大部分的机器学习模型训练及预测任务。具体来说,SQLFlow由何而来?它与谷歌发布的BigQueryML有何不同之处?SQLFlow的研发团队认为,在SQLFlow和AI引擎之间存在一个很大的空隙——如何把数据变成AI模型需要的输入。SQLFlow的架构设计设计目标在连接SQL和AI应用这一方向上,业内已有相关工作。SQLFlow可以看作一个翻译器,它把扩展语法的SQL程序翻译成一个被称为submitter的程序,然后执行。SQLFlow对SQL语法的扩展意图很简单:在SELECT语句后面,加上一个扩展语法的TRAIN从句,即可实现AI模型的训练。SQLFlow的开源项目链接为:https://sqlflow.org/sqlflow。

本页网址:https://www.xinzhibang.net/article_detail-12208.html

寻求报道,请 点击这里 微信扫码咨询

相关工具

相关文章